Hello,



How do I set the email button so that the form is mailed and not the data in XML format?



Thank you.
6 Replies

Avatar

Former Community Member
Select the email submit button, click the XML Source tab (enable it in the view menu if you don't see it), and change the format attribute of the submit node from "xml" to "pdf".



You should know that Reader is unable to submit the PDF unless usage rights have been applied using Reader Extensions. If the client is Reader and you don't have RE you should continue submitting xml.

Reader Extensions is an enterprise server product in the LiveCycle family. You can read more about it here:



http://www.adobe.com/products/server/readerextensions/
